15. INSURANCE. Contractor will acquire and maintain Workers <br /> Compensation, employer's liability, comprehensive general liability, owned, non - <br /> owned, and hired automobile liability insurance coverage relating to Contractor's <br /> activities funded hereunder covering City's risk subject to the approval of the City <br /> Attorney.
